Webb25 apr. 2016 · So if you flip six coins, here’s how many possible outcomes you have: 2 2 2 2 2 2 = 64. The number of possible outcomes equals the number of outcomes per coin (2) raised to the number of coins (6): Mathematically, you have 2 6 = 64. Webb19 feb. 2013 · The probability of all three tosses is heads: P ( three heads) = 1 × 1 + 99 × 1 8 100. The probability of three heads given the biased coin is trivial: P ( three heads biased coin) = 1. If we use Bayes' Theorem from above, we can calculate P ( biased coin three heads) = 1 × 1 / 100 1 + 99 × 1 8 100 = 1 1 + 99 × 1 8 = 8 107 ≈ 0.07476636 Share
